What is the Aircraft Insurance Application?
The Aircraft Insurance Application is a critical document utilized by individuals and corporations seeking coverage for their aircraft. This form is designed to collect specific information regarding the applicant, aircraft specifics, and pilots who will operate the aircraft. By ensuring thorough completion of the form, applicants can better protect their assets and comply with regulations.
This application is particularly important for both private aircraft owners and commercial operators, as it plays a key role in securing the appropriate aviation insurance necessary to mitigate risks associated with aircraft ownership and operation.

Key Features of the Aircraft Insurance Application
The aircraft insurance application includes several important sections that require detailed input from the applicant. Key features consist of:
-
A detailed overview of the aircraft such as make, model, and year
-
Ownership details to confirm who is responsible for the aircraft
-
Coverage limits to define the extent of protection sought
-
Accident history to assess previous incidents
This aviation insurance application also features fillable fields and checkboxes that streamline data entry and enhance usability.

Field-by-Field Instructions for the Aircraft Insurance Application
To ensure accuracy when filling out the application, here are field-by-field instructions for common sections:
-
Aircraft Details: Provide accurate make, model, and year. Common errors include typos and incorrect information.
-
Ownership Information: Confirm ownership status, distinguishing between individual and corporate ownership.
-
Coverage Limits: Clearly specify desired limits to avoid underinsurance.
-
Accident History: Be truthful about past incidents to establish credibility.
Avoiding these common mistakes can greatly enhance the application's effectiveness.

What supporting documents do I need to provide?
You may need to submit documents such as proof of aircraft ownership, pilot certifications, and any prior insurance policies. Check with your insurance provider for specific requirements.
